Fresh bread when you wake up and mornings spent mingling with the resident farm animals… sound like your kind of break? If so, head to Camping Les Arbois, a family-friendly place five minutes' drive from Saint-Germain-du-Bois and Montjay, in the Saône-et-Loire department. All sorts of animals reside here, including a donkey, goats, chickens, guinea pigs, rabbits, and a pony, so you’ll be in good rural company. Guests are invited to help feed the gang in the morning and are allowed to pet the animals under supervision. Animals taken care of, turn your attention to the rest of the on-site facilities. For days spent chilling at base, get comfy on one of the sun loungers, or dial the effort up a notch with a dip in the outdoor pool and a game or two on the pétanque court. Kids can blow off steam at the playground (the climbing tower and trampoline are particular favourites) or try go-karting; for smaller children, there's also a treasure hunt. There’s a terrace area where guests can mingle; the coffee (and wine) and twice-weekly table d'hôte should go down nicely after days out walking and cycling. On the days when there isn't table d'hôte, the restaurant serves pizzas or quiche. There’s also a food shop on site selling local produce; order fresh, warm bread for the mornings and fresh, local organic veggies to be delivered once per week. The amenity block has showers, toilets and sinks, and kids get their own low toilet and sink. You won’t need to scramble around in the dark to find the loos either, as the site is lit at night. In Saint-Germain-du-Bois (five minutes' drive away), there's a charger for electric vehicles, plus a supermarket and local shops for more day-to-day groceries.

Local attractions

If you ever find yourself in the mood for a swim, there's a pretty biological lake on the outskirts of La Chapelle-Saint-Sauveur: Baignade Naturelle (10 minutes' drive). France’s Jura region is slightly further – about 45 minutes – but the area’s backdrop of mountains, vineyards, waterfalls and lakes makes for some scenic strolls, as do the Baume Caves (45 minutes). Dairy fans might like to visit the cheese museum La Maison de la Vache Qui Rit (35 minutes) for lessons in cheesemaking. Centre Eden (40 minutes) is another nice pick for those who like museums; this one's nature-focused, with a good cabinet of curiosities for kids to ogle over. For a different kind of history, tours of Château d'Arlay (half an hour) stop by grand rooms with 19th-century period decorations and an old cellar once home to a convent of monks. As for more family days out, pack up the car and choose between a waterpark, Jura Splash (25 minutes), and rides aplenty at the Parc des Combes amusement park (an hour and 10 minutes). You could also wander over to the Camping Les Arbois reception, where there are plenty more ideas for days out, as well as information on walks and biking tours that begin from the site.
